If you’d like to perform the same kind of edits that you can in a regular iMovie project, you must convert the trailer to a movie. To close the Clip Trimmer, click the X that appears to the left of ‘Close Clip Trimmer.’ The process involves choosing a different starting point for the clip by clicking that location within the Clip Trimmer, after which the clip adjusts accordingly to fill the slot. I’ll discuss the Clip Trimmer in greater detail in our next lesson for the time being, understand that it helps you make finer adjustments to a clip’s length. (By default, clip audio is muted.) In this case both the clip’s audio and the music soundtrack that accompanies the trailer will play.Ĭlick the Adjust icon that appears in the bottom-left corner of the clip to reveal the Clip Trimmer. Click the Audio icon, and you can turn on the audio track for that clip. It will automatically occupy the slot, and it will last for exactly as long as the slot allows.Īs you hover your cursor over one of these filled slots, you’ll discover two other options. To add a clip, move to the Browser pane, find the still or clip you’d like to use, and click it at the point where you want the clip to begin.

Filling these slots couldn’t be much easier.Įach slot indicates its length and the kind of shot it is-a close-up image of one of the characters (your child, for instance) or a landscape, wide, medium, group, or two-shot (a shot that shows two people in the frame). Storyboard: In the Storyboard tab you enter interstitial text (for example, “Pow!” “Intrigue!” or “Meanwhile…”) and place clips or stills to fill the video slots within the template.

You enter title and credit information in the Outline tab. Click it, and you can choose Normal, Film Noir, or Black & White. With some templates you’ll additionally see a Video Style pop-up menu. Outline: In this case, “Outline” is a cute name for “title information.” Here you enter the time and date of your movie, as well as the information that will appear in the Cast, Studio, and Credits screens.
